List of the Legendary Bollywood playback singers who sang for Gujarati films

There is a long trail of Indian playback singers who have been adding charm to the Indian music industry with their blessed voices. The Bollywood music industry is constantly evolving and with passing time is increasingly showing interest in the Dhollywood industry. While there may be many to name, here is a list of the top six legendary Bollywood playback singers who have sung for Gujarati films.

Sunidhi Chauhan

Sunidhi Chauhan

Most recently the iconic singer Sunidhi Chauhan made her Gujarati debut with the film Ratanpur in which the singer sang ‘Ude Ajje’. Many Bollywood playback singers have shown similar interest and have happily embraced the Dhollywood style.

Alka Yagnik

Alka Yagnik

After achieving several music awards for being the best female playback singer that includes National Awards, multiple Filmfare Awards, Alka Yagnik has been tagged to the Gujarati film industry for over three decades now. The iconic singer has also been best known for her romantic Gujarati tracks. ‘Kalja No Katko’ was her last track that comes from the social comedy film Carry on Kesar, released in 2017.

Hemlata

Singer Hemlata has given the audience several super-hit songs for Bollywood and also for the Gujarati film industry since the late 1970s. Some of her most famous Gujarati tracks include ‘Shankar Tari Jatama’ and ‘Om Namah Shivaye’ that comes from the 1981 movie Amar Rahe Taro Chandlo.

Lata Mangeshkar

Lata Mangeshkar

Being honored with Padma Bhushan and Dadasaheb Phalke Award- the most legendary playback singer Lata Mangeshkar has recorded more than thousands of film songs and has sung in over 36 regional languages and foreign languages, that includes Gujarati too. Some of her most famous Gujarati film works include ‘Ghunghate Dhankun Re Ek Kodiyun’ that comes from the movie Mehndi Rang Lagyo and ‘Dhari Kanku Kankan Panetar’ that comes from the film Lalwadi Pholwadi.

Shaan singer

Shann

An extremely versatile artist, Shaan is a playback singer-cum-music director-cum-host-cum-actor who has been a part of numerous urban Gujarati films. The singer has sung for Gujarati songs like ‘Mane Kon Aa’ from the movie Better Half and also the party song ‘Chuski’ from the 2017 film named Pappa Tamne Nahi Samjaay, and also the title track for the film Wassup Zindagi.

Arijit Singh

Arijit Singh

Within a short span of a couple of years, Arijit Singh has received numerous awards and several honors. Arijit made his debut in the Gujarati film industry with the song ‘Satrangi Re’ from the film Wrong Side Raju. This soulful track sung by the very popular Arijit Singh was composed by the well-known music composer duo Sachin-Jigar.
